Читаем Bash.org.ru IT Happens Истории ## 3501 – 3600 полностью

<p>#3519: Сороконожки-гриль</p>

16:45 01.07.2010, IT happens

В отдалённые времена дома стоял системник со старым добрым четвёртым пнем на 3 GHz на борту. Системник радовал игрушками и интернетом, но, гад такой, грелся, как любой правильный четвёртый пень. Будучи тогда не сильно в ладах с техникой, первый тревожный звонок я пропустил — тормозит и тормозит, бывает. Потом комп стал перезагружаться. Потом он прожёг к чертям материнскую плату, и в ответ на моё «Разве 85 градусов для него не нормально?» вызванный компьютерный мастер только вздохнул. Огарок извлекли из сокета, счистили запёкшуюся до антрацитового цвета пыль и термопасту, засунули в новую мать, и компьютер снова ожил.

Спустя полгода при повторении тех же симптомов, памятуя о наставлении мастера почаще чистить системник, я залез внутрь и обнаружил, что мой огарок намертво схватился с собственным радиатором, будто клеем намазали. Ладно, вытащил из сокета, почистил радиатор, время вставлять обратно. Опа — из-за радиатора ни хрена не видно, куда совать. Не проблема: ножек много, везде одинаковые. Радиатор с силой прижимается к сокету, под жалобное «хрусть» затягиваются рычажки, ломая последние уцелевшие ножки... Та-дам — и первая жертва неопытного хирурга наконец издохла в корчах.

Эта история заставила так стыдиться собственного невежества, что волей-неволей пришлось становится айтишником и постоянно учиться новому. Труп моего невинно убиенного камня сейчас бережно хранится на полке как талисман, напоминание и упрёк.

<p>#3520: Обезжиривание штатными средствами</p>

16:45 01.07.2010, IT happens

Понадобилось мне скачать образ в 5,5 ГБ. Запускаю торрент, а тот ругается на размер файла. Почуяв неладное, проверяю файловые системы. Диск С — NTFS, диск D — FAT32. Шок: как это «семёрка» за меня при установке решила?

Качаю известную в широких кругах утилиту для работы с HDD. Установка, запуск, «Конвертируй в NTFS», — приказываю я программе. «ОК!» — радостно заявляет мне та. Просит перезагрузку, соглашаюсь. Чёрный экран, радостные буковки и циферки сообщают мне, сколько места занимают файлы и какого размера вообще этот раздел. Подумав какое-то время, программа бодро выдаёт сообщение об успешном завершении операции.

Загружается Windows 7. Проверяю — ничего не изменилось! Полминуты раздумий. Командная строка с админскими правами, convert D: /fs:ntfs. Две минуты ожидания — система сменилась на NTFS, перезагрузки не потребовалась.

Стоило ли тащить утилиту с внешки с урезанным каналом, чтобы потом всё решить стандартной командой? Вот она, лень-матушка! Зачем писать? Сейчас скачаем, нажмём — и вуаля. Ан нет, не всё так просто, как показывает практика.

<p>#3521: ChaosDB</p>

20:45 01.07.2010, IT happens

Проектировал изначально небольшую и простую базу данных для маленькой, но гордой аутсорсинговой компании. Пришёл к следующим законам Мерфи для реляционных баз данных:

1. Не существует отношений «один к одному». Все такие отношения вырождаются в «один ко многим». Проявляются после написания полного и подробного ТЗ.

2. Не существует отношений «один ко многим» — все они вырождаются в «многие ко многим». Появляются после слов заказчика: «Может быть только так и никак иначе».

3. Не существует отношений «многие ко многим» — все они вырождаются в направленные графы. Появляются после слов заказчика: «А давайте сделаем так, чтобы когда я чешу за ухом, у меня шнурки завязывались».

4. Не существует направленных графов. Есть просто графы. Появляются после описания всех возможных и невозможных связей.

5. Не существует графов. Есть хаос.

Через полтора месяца ежедневного выноса мозгов к работе над проектом подключился главный директор, через три дня был уволен технический директор (тот, с которым я всё это время общался), а через пару недель макет БД был полностью написан и передан прикладным программистам для интеграции.

<p>#3522: Монтаж а-ля рюс: заюз, индус</p>

20:45 01.07.2010, IT happens

Довелось в жизни поработать на должности, гордо именуемой «монтажник ЛВС». Были на моей памяти и засранные чердаки, и клиенты-идиоты, и трубы с горячей водой, лопающиеся в метре от физиономии, но особо запомнилась эта история.

Обычное рабочее утро. Собирается разношёрстный коллектив монтажников в кабинете у начальника поучаствовать в лотерее: на бумажках расписаны подключения на грядущий день. Практически каждый раз попадалась парочка листочков, получить которые для любой бригады было той ещё трагедией. Это были подключения в 22-этажных домах: одинокая оплывшая свечка на чердаке, коммуникации между этажами забиты мусором настолько, что проще сказать, что их вообще нет. Протягивая витуху, приходилось натыкаться и на песок, и на непонятно зачем туда вставленные бамбуковые палки. Маловольтные стояки жители частенько заливали цементом — а то ходют тут, понимаешь, в моём щитке кабеля какие-то тянут!

Перейти на страницу:

Все книги серии Bash.org.ru IT Happens

Похожие книги